Pondicherry
By Our Staff Reporter
PONDICHERRY, DEC. 9. The police have registered a case against the chairman of the PNL Nidhi Limited here on a complaint from a depositor that the chairman had "misappropriated and cheated" him of Rs. 5 lakhs. The Senior Superintendent of Police, Kannan Jegadeesan, said here today that Mr. Boothathan, a resident of Tiruvenainallooor village in Tamil Nadu,had complained on December 7 that he had deposited the Rs. 5 lakh in the nidhi on April 5, but the company had stopped doing business from September this year. He had thereby been cheated of his money. Police had registered a case under section 420 (cheating and dishonestly inducing delivery of property) and also under section 409 (criminal breach of trust) of the Indian Penal Code has been registered. The release said that the police had initiated investigation into the case.
